Manchester United could hand Man City two titles after latest Arsenal run-in twist

manchestereveningnews.co.uk

It's business as usual in the Premier League, as Manchester City responded to Arsenal's big win on Saturday with a thrashing of Wolves to remain in control of their own title destiny.

Three wins from their remaining three games will hand City the title, even if there are potentially tricky away games at Fulham and Tottenham in the space of four days.

If City slip up, Arsenal could overtake them with two wins from their last two games, so the Blues will hope to get a favour from rivals Manchester United next Sunday when Arsenal visit Old Trafford.

While Pep Guardiola's side are in a position of strength, they know what will happen if they drop their standards, with the margins as fine as any of their previous title races under the manager.
